If you live in a country which adopts summer
time, the following setting will be necessary.
When you change from winter to summer time,
please proceed as follows:
- While turning Crown B (at 10 o’clock), position
the “  
  
” symbol found to the left of the city
that corresponds to the time zone in which
you find yourself (reference city) opposite the
triangular marker at 6 o’clock.
- Pull Crown A out to position 2 and wind
forward one hour to display the time in the
reference city.
- Push Crown A back to position 1 and wind
the time in the small dial back by one hour
(counter-clockwise) in order to display the
same time as on the main dial.
- Push Crown A back to position 0.
